Foundations

The program in Foundations supports research in mathematical logic and the foundations of mathematics, including proof theory, recursion theory, model theory, set theory, and infinitary combinatorics. Conferences Principal Investigators should carefully read the program solicitation "Conferences and Workshops in the Mathematical Sciences" (link below) to obtain important information regarding the substance of proposals for conferences, workshops, summer/winter schools, and similar activities. Conference and workshop proposals should be submitted eight months before the requested start date.

Security, Privacy, and Trust in Cyberspace

<p class="paragraph">Our world is at a pivotal moment where the boundaries dividing the physical and social worlds from the cyber world have become blurred. Cyberspace has evolved from an interconnected digital environment into a complex and interdependent cyber ecosystem that involves hardware, software, networks, data, people, organizations, countries, and the physical world. Critical functions of everyday life are deeply intertwined with computing, including health, government, commerce, the public sphere, education, critical infrastructure, interpersonal communication, and transportation. The complexity and inter-dependencies in cyberspace can be misused and exploited by malicious actors. These in turn can trigger adverse outcomes such as disruption of critical infrastructure and systems; theft of intellectual property and sensitive data; amplification of inequalities; disclosure of private information of individuals, organizations, and governments; and threats to lives, livelihoods, and reputations. Furthermore, constant attacks on the data and assets of corporations, governments, and individuals undermine people&rsquo;s trust in decision-making and processes that depend critically on these cyber systems. <p class="paragraph">The Security, Privacy, and Trust in Cyberspace (SaTC 2.0) program aims to build trust in global cyber ecosystems. Trust is the core tenet of this program and, for the purposes of this solicitation, is broadly defined to include our confidence in the security, privacy, and resilience of cyberspace, particularly in the face of malicious intent. Achieving this level of confidence in cyberspace requires not only understanding the vulnerabilities in a system that could be exploited and how they can be addressed, but also understanding the social and technical dimensions of trust in cyber systems, along with the educational efforts needed to increase public awareness of risks in cyberspace, and building a well-trained corps of privacy and security professionals. SaTC 2.0 spans the interests of NSF's Directorates for Computer and Information Science and Engineering (CISE), Mathematical and Physical Sciences (MPS), Social, Behavioral and Economic Sciences (SBE), and STEM Education (EDU). Proposals must be submitted pursuant to one of the following designations, each of which may have additional requirements: <ul> <li>RES: The Research (RES) designation is the focus of the multidisciplinary SaTC 2.0 research program. RES projects are limited to $1,200,000 in total budget, with durations of up to four years. Proposals with a total budget of more than $600,000 have additional requirements including Broadening Participation in Computing and collaboration plans. RES proposals may include an optional Transition to Education (TTE) plan with a budget up to $50,000 (within the RES total budget request) to co-evolve novel educational initiatives in the context of the proposed research.</li> <li>EDU: The Education (EDU) designation is used to identify proposals focusing on education and workforce training in building trust in security, privacy, and resilience of cyberspace. EDU proposals are limited to $500,000 in total budget, with durations of up to three years. EDU proposals that primarily focus on education research with demonstrated collaboration, as reflected in the PI team between cybersecurity subject matter experts and education researcher(s), may request an additional $100,000 beyond the $500,000 limit.</li> <li>SEED: The Seedling (SEED) category is intended for special topics defined by accompanying Dear Colleague Letters. SEED projects are limited to $300,000 in total budget, with durations of up to two years.</li> </ul>

ECosystem for Leading Innovation in Plasma Science and Engineering (ECLIPSE)

<p>Plasma science is a transdisciplinary field of research where fundamental studies in many disciplines, including plasma physics, plasma chemistry, materials science, and space science, come together to advance knowledge for discovery and technological innovation.&nbsp; The primary goal of the <span style="text-decoration: underline;">EC</span>osystem for&nbsp;<span style="text-decoration: underline;">L</span>eading&nbsp;<span style="text-decoration: underline;">I</span>nnovation in&nbsp;<span style="text-decoration: underline;">P</span>lasma&nbsp;<span style="text-decoration: underline;">S</span>cience and&nbsp;<span style="text-decoration: underline;">E</span>ngineering (ECLIPSE) program is to identify and capitalize on opportunities for bringing fundamental plasma science investigations to bear on problems of societal and technological need within the scope of science and engineering supported by the participating NSF programs.</p> <p>The ECLIPSE meta-program has been created to foster an inclusive community of scientists and engineers, an ecosystem spanning multiple NSF Directorates, in the pursuit of translational research at the interface of fundamental plasma science and technological innovation.&nbsp; The ECLIPSE program builds on the long history of NSF leadership in supporting multi-disciplinary research in plasma science and engineering, and is intended to enhance organizational unity within NSF, and potentially with other funding agencies, in considering proposals and supporting projects that may otherwise struggle to find a natural home within the existing hierarchy of Directorates, Divisions, and programs within the Foundation.</p> <p>Examples of topical areas within the scope of the ECLIPSE program include but are not limited to:</p> <ul type="disc"> <li>Plasma surface interactions, <em>with applications to</em>, e.g., advanced manufacturing, materials processing, and catalysis.</li> <li>Atmospheric pressure plasmas and microplasmas <em>with applications to</em>, e.g., microelectronics, plasma agriculture, environmental remediation, and other clean and decarbonized energy goals enabled by electrification of the chemical industry.</li> <li>Dusty plasmas <em>with applications to</em>, e.g., development of nanomaterials, aerosols, and functionalized surface coatings.</li> <li>Novel sensor development for highly non-equilibrium plasmas <em>with applications to</em>, e.g., cubesat-based geospace measurements and industrial plasma diagnostics.</li> <li>Novel computational modeling for multi-component and/or multi-phase plasma systems <em>with applications to</em>, e.g., space weather prediction and plasma reactor design.</li> <li>Novel studies of plasmons in nano-photonics and nano-optics <em>with applications to</em>, e.g., sub-THz wireless communication and photocatalytic chemical processes.</li> <li>New chemical measurement science for characterizing processes occurring in plasmas and using plasmas as part of measurement systems <em>with applications to</em>, e.g., analysis of environmental contaminants or identification of forensic evidence.</li> <li>Study of fundamental chemical reactions and mechanisms in plasmas <em>with applications </em><em>to</em>, e.g., novel chemical synthesis.</li> </ul> <p>Proposals submitted for consideration by this program should address societal or technological needs within the scope of science and engineering supported by the National Science Foundation.&nbsp; Proposals addressing technology development primarily supported by other US government funding agencies are not eligible for consideration and may be returned without review.&nbsp; Proposers are strongly encouraged to contact the cognizant Program Officers if they are unsure of the suitability of a project to this program.</p> <p>Proposals submitted for consideration by the ECLIPSE program should satisfy the following criteria:</p> <p>(1) clearly articulate the fundamental scientific and/or engineering challenge in plasma science and engineering that may be relevant to more than one NSF program;<ins cite="mailto:Mangala%20Sharma" datetime="2021-06-04T14:45"></ins> and</p> <p>(2) provide a substantive discussion of how a resolution of the stated scientific and/or engineering challenge will address specific societal and/or technological needs identified as priorities by the research communities, policymakers and/or other stakeholders. Depending on the nature of the proposal, the latter may be described as the Intellectual Merit or the Broader Impact of the proposed activity.&nbsp;&nbsp;</p> <p>The program encourages inclusion of specific efforts to increase the diversity of the ECLIPSE community and to broaden participation of under-represented groups in Science, Technology, Engineering, and Mathematics (STEM) as Broader Impacts of proposed work.&nbsp; The program welcomes proposals from Historically Black Colleges and Universities (HBCUs), other Minority Serving Institutions (MSIs), and institutions in <a href="https://new.nsf.gov/funding/initiatives/epscor/epscor-criteria-eligibility" target="_blank">EPSCoR-eligible jurisdictions</a>, along with collaborations between these institutions.&nbsp; Proposers are also encouraged to address how the proposed efforts may enhance workforce development towards STEM careers associated with the field of plasma science and engineering.</p> <p>The ECLIPSE program is not intended to replace existing programs.&nbsp; A proposal that is requesting consideration within the context of ECLIPSE should begin the title with the identifying acronym "ECLIPSE:" and should be submitted to one of the "Related Programs" listed below. In choosing the most relevant program, proposers are advised to read program descriptions and solicitations carefully and to consult with cognizant Program Officers in advance of proposal preparation. Proposal submissions outside of the scientific scope of the receiving program may be transferred to a different program or may be returned without review. <strong>Proposers should ask for consideration and review as an ECLIPSE proposal only if the proposal addresses both of the criteria listed above.&nbsp;</strong> Proposals marked for consideration by the ECLIPSE program that do not address both of these criteria may be returned without review or reviewed within the context of an individual program. Supplement requests to existing awards within a program that address both of the above criteria may also be considered.</p> <p><strong>Information Sharing with other Funding Agencies</strong></p> <p>When permitted under an MOU between NSF and another funding agency, NSF may share information from proposals for consideration of joint funding and may invite employees of such organizations to attend merit review panels as observers.</p>

Postdoctoral Research Fellowships in Biology

The integration of Artificial Intelligence (AI) and Biological Research has the potential to pave the way for breakthroughs in biotechnology and bio-system design that will create innovations, new industries, and jobs. To capitalize on this promise, the Directorate for Biological Sciences (BIO) will make awards for Postdoctoral Research Fellowships in Biology (PRFB) to recent doctoral degree recipients, for proposals with a research and training focus at the Intersection of Artificial Intelligence and Biological Sciences to Strengthen and Safeguard Biotechnology Innovations. Applying AI to highly complex biological systems will reveal unknown mechanisms in the natural world that hold promise for technological developments. Candidates with AI and/or biology experience will develop deep expertise in both by proposing additional training in both areas. These combinations of current expertise and new cross-training will produce scientists who work seamlessly at the intersection of AI and biology. The fellows are expected to become field leaders who use AI capabilities to extrapolate from biological data to technological advances. Proposers are encouraged to consider how to leverage the nation&rsquo;s diversity of existing biological data, and biological infrastructure, such as Biofoundries, Programmable Cloud Labs, Manufacturing USA Institutes, and NEON, to accelerate discovery, innovation and the biotechnology that improves human lives, promotes the U.S. economy, and benefits the nation.

Analysis

The Analysis Program supports research in analysis. Areas of current activity include complex, harmonic, and real analysis; dynamical systems and ergodic theory; functional analysis; mathematical physics; operator theory and operator algebras; partial differential equations and calculus of variations. Conferences Proposals to the Analysis Program for conferences or workshops must be submitted through the program solicitation "Conferences and Workshops in the Mathematical Sciences" (link below). Principal Investigators should carefully read the solicitation to obtain important information regarding the substance of proposals for conferences, workshops, and similar activities. To facilitate timely notification of the availability of support, proposals for conferences, workshops, and similar activities should be submitted 8 months in advance of the start date of the proposed event.
